 Description   

sanity-quota test_1 is failing in a DNE configuration, review-dne-part-4, with

'user write success, but expect EDQUOT' 

meaning that the user write, dd, should not have succeeded.

Comment by Andreas Dilger [ 30/Nov/18 ]

This problem only started being hit on 2018-11-13, so it very likely relates to one of the two quota patches landed on that day:

 LU-11425 quota: support quota for DoM
    
    Support block quota enforcement on MDT to accommodate the data
    writing introduced by DoM.
    
    This patch adds a new qsd_instance on the OSD device at MDT to
    implement the quota enforcement on block data, for there is only
    one type of quota (meta data or block data) to be handled in one
    qsd_instance in the current quota design of Lustre, it's much more
    changes to adapt the qsd_instance to support more quota type than
    to use a separated qsd_instance to enfore meta data on MDT.
    
    Change-Id: I7c57f383d338cf0070e05ecc318d42586c39371e
    Reviewed-on: https://review.whamcloud.com/33257

or

LU-11390 quota: mark over-quota flag correctly
    
    Currently, if the current granted quota space is less than or
    equal to the usage + pending_write + waiting_write, the over-quota
    flag will be marked and sent back to OSC, it will damage the write
    performance drastically. this patch will compare the current pending
    and the waiting space to the threshold of over-quota check, and the
    threshold will be taken into account only if the remain margin quota
    space is larger than the threshold.
    
    Test-Parameters: mdtfilesystemtype=zfs ostfilesystemtype=zfs \
    testlist=sanity-quota,sanity-quota,sanity-quota,sanity-quota,sanity-quota
    
    Change-Id: I0ecd134c3119ec1d86dbaa6e668091a68b7f5f54
    Reviewed-on: https://review.whamcloud.com/33238

Comment by Hongchao Zhang [ 04/Dec/18 ]

Hi Andres,
It could be related to the patch in LU-11390, which modified the condition to check the pending over-quota flag and this issue
is just caused by the improper processing of this flag.

Comment by Andreas Dilger [ 05/Dec/18 ]

Hongchao, does your patch 33747 fix the problem related to the patch from LU-11390, or is another patch needed?

Comment by Hongchao Zhang [ 07/Dec/18 ]

Hi, Andreas,
The problem fixed by the patch 33747 exists before the patch from LU-11390, the problem is easily triggered because
the pending over quota flag is not sent back long time before the quota is really over quota after the patch
from LU-11390 was landed, which means the minor disorder of the replies can't trigger the issue.
